Cosumnes River College delivered a wire-to-wire dominant performance, cruising to a commanding 97–47 win over Solano. The Hawks buried the game early with a stunning 63-point first half, overwhelming Solano on both ends and setting the tone for one of their most complete performances of the season.
Leading the charge was Aalijah Gillyard, who provided a huge spark off the bench with a double-double of 10 points and 11 rebounds, anchoring Cosumnes River's effort on the glass and in the paint. The Hawks shot 55.8 percent from the floor, recorded 23 assists, and consistently found high-quality looks through sharp ball movement.
CRC's defensive pressure was equally decisive, forcing 18 turnovers while holding Solano under 26 percent shooting. With balanced scoring throughout the lineup and sustained intensity for all 40 minutes, Cosumnes River College showcased its depth and dominance, leaving no doubt in a statement road victory.
